Tesseract and Beyond: Exploring Higher Dimensional Spaces
The concept of dimensionality extends beyond our everyday perception of three spatial dimensions. While we navigate a world defined by length, width, and height, mathematicians and physicists delve into realms of four or even higher dimensions. The tesseract, a four-dimensional cube, serves as a intriguing example of this, offering glimpses into uncharted spatial configurations.
Visualizing these higher dimensions yields a significant challenge, as our brains are programmed to process only three. Yet, abstract models and simulations help us to grasp the complexities of these multidimensional spaces.
